FIFTY-MEMBER BUSINESS DELEGATION FROM INDIA VISITS MSIA



KUALA LUMPUR, March 23 (Bernama) -- A 50-member business delegation from
India, representing the chemical industry, met their Malaysian counterparts
today at a Buyer and Seller Meet (BSM) session.

During the session, the Indian delegation also held intensive discussions
with their Malaysian counterparts, with a view to establishing an initial tie-up
and also explore possibilities for joint ventures between companies of both
nations.

Besides that, the session also looked into appointing local representatives
for their products, particularly chemicals, agrochemicals, dye and dye
intermediates, flavours and grangrances.

The BSM was organised by the Indian Basic Chemicals Pharmaceuticals and
Cosmetics Export Promotion Council (CHEMEXCIL) with the support of the Indian
High Commission in Malaysia.

The High Commission in a statement said the Chemical Industries Council of
Malaysia, Malaysian Association of Traditional Indian Medicine, senior
representatives from the Kuala Lumpur and Selangor Indian Chamber of Commerce,
the Malay Chamber of Commerce and the Chinese Chamber of Commerce, participated
in the BSM.

India's exports of chemical and chemical-based products to Malaysia
increased three-fold between 2003 to 2008.

Significantly, India's exports of chemicals and chemical products registered
a 25 per cent increase in 2009 compared to 2008.
